原文:python定义函数时默认参数注意事项

如果在调用一个函数时,没有传递默认参数,则函数内的默认参数是对函数的默认参数属性 defaults 的引用, 如 调用func时如果没有传参,上面的arg 就是func. defaults 的引用 没传递默认参数,会发生以下情况 由于func. defaults 是可变类型,导致每一次调用func,arg 都会对func. defaults 进行操作 func. defaults .append ...

2017-10-22 16:03 0 6228 推荐指数:

查看详情

Lua 函数作为参数传递注意事项

有一个函数是这样的: function Car:setSpeed(t_speed)   self.speed = t_speed   print(self.speed) end 我准备调用回调函数函数: function CarDriver:tapGas(self ...

Thu Apr 03 02:00:00 CST 2014 0 2494
Python命令行参数定义注意事项

  在命令行中运行python代码是很常见的,下面介绍如何定义命令后面跟的参数。 常规用法   Python代码中主要使用下面几行代码来定义并获取需要在命令行中赋值的参数:   注释:   1、获取外部参数对象实例。可以传入字符串来描述总体的外部参数。   2、定义外部参数 ...

Mon Nov 30 21:19:00 CST 2020 0 426
Python函数的正确用法及其注意事项

简单总结: 与类和实例无绑定关系的function都属于函数(function); 与类和实例有绑定关系的function都属于方法(method)。 首先摒弃错误认知:并不是类中的调用都叫方法 函数(FunctionType) 函数是封装了一些独立的功能,可以直接调用,能将 ...

Sun Aug 08 04:54:00 CST 2021 0 153
vue 组件模板template定义注意事项

在创建组件的时候,需要定义模板对象,注意 : template 的 value值: 1、通常是一个字符串,该字符串中如果存在多层div嵌套,肯定存在换行,此时不应该使用单引号,而应该使用 键盘上左上角 数字1左边的那个键 · ; 2、该value的值(字符串)外层,必须有一个跟元素(例如div ...

Thu Sep 26 05:34:00 CST 2019 0 407
c语言数组在作为参数传递注意事项

1、不能在[]给定大小 2、不要在被调用函数里使用sizeof(a)/sizeof(a[0])形式传递数组大小,直接给出数组长度,或者在 主调函数中使用sizeof(a)/sizeof(a[0])传递长度 ...

Sun Aug 11 03:44:00 CST 2019 0 1179
定义HTTP头注意事项(转)

原文:https://blog.gnuers.org/?p=462 HTTP头是可以包含英文字母([A-Za-z])、数字([0-9])、连接号(-)hyphens, 也可义是下划线(_)。在使用nginx的时候应该避免使用包含下划线的HTTP头。主要的原因有以下2点。 1.默认的情况下 ...

Tue Nov 18 05:41:00 CST 2014 0 8702
 
粤ICP备18138465号  © 2018-2026 CODEPRJ.COM